Reading files: ZoneModa Journal’s issue on global fashion

From the editorial:

The ZMJ 9.2 issue—edited by Wessie Ling, Mariella Lorusso, and Simona Segre Reinach, is devoted to the analysis of different aspects of fashion globalization in our time. Globalization presents ambiguities and contradictions, especially evident when it comes to fashion, an area in which the interplay between global and local is particularly intense.

The issue includes nine contributions focusing on specific sectors, places and themes of fashion globalization, as evident in the practices and ideas of different subjects and from different parts of the world. The presence of anthropologists among the authors of the issue confirms how much a cultural analysis of the economic and aesthetic processes of global fashion is necessary.
